Princess Breaks Silence Reacts As Police Grants Baba Ijesha Bail

Thompson Nsisongabasi
May 18, 2021
Share

Popular Comedian, Princess has reacted as the Lagos State Police Command granted bail to Nollywood actor, Olanrewaju James, AKA Baba Ijesha accused of s-exually assaulting her foster child.

Recall Baba Ijesha who has been in detention for weeks after he was arrested for alleged s-exual molestation of a 14-year-old girl was granted bail by the police on Monday.

His Lawyer, Adesina Ogunlana said he was granted bail on health grounds.

He explained that his client was granted administrative bail by the police in the sum of N500,000 with two sureties.

”The terms of the bail include two reliable sureties- a blood relation and a level 10 civil servant,” he said.

Reacting, Princess in a post on her Instagram page said she would definitely win the case.

She wrote,

“I won’t win right away, but definitely.

“#Goddoesnotsleep #Godloveschildren #Saynotochilddefilement #Saynotorape #Saysomethingifyouseesomething.”
